1 / 25 IPM CMMI Integrated Project Management (IPM) Dieter De Paepe & Sarah Bourgeois.

Slides:



Advertisements
Similar presentations
Integrated Project Management IPM (Without IPPD) Intermediate Concepts of CMMI Project meets the organization Author: Kiril Karaatanasov
Advertisements

Process and Product Quality Assurance (PPQA)
Implementing CMMI® for Development Version 1.3
SPIN-BG Seminar 1.Overview of CMMI Model changes 3.SCAMPI method changes 4.Training changes 5.CMMI Architecture Author: Kiril Karaatanasov
Kelemen Zádor Dániel  About ISO 9001: 2000  About CMMI v1.2  Main differences  Differences in terminology  Similarities 
Chapter 7: Key Process Areas for Level 2: Repeatable - Arvind Kabir Yateesh.
More CMM Part Two : Details.
For internal use Project Management at a glance - the ‘what’ and the ‘how’ Jørgen Nygaard Nielsen Dan Bandsholm Erensø PMD –
Copyright 2005 CMMI and ITIL Alison Adams & Kieran Doyle.
SM CMM Integration, SCAMPI, SCAMPI Lead Assessor, SCAMPI Lead Appraiser, and SEI are service marks of Carnegie Mellon University.  CMM and CMMI are registered.
© SPI PARTNERS, 2003, 1 ESEPG Conference London, Tutorial Tom Gilb & Simon Porro How Competitive Engineering (Tom Gilb) Supports.
CMMI PMC Group Members Inam ul Haq Sajjad Raza Nabeel Azam
Lecture 2b: Software Project Management CSCI102 - Introduction to Information Technology B ITCS905 - Fundamentals of Information Technology.
Capability Maturity Model Integration (CMMI). CMMI Enterprise-wide process improvement framework Focuses on processes for improved product Process areas:
CMMI December 3rd 2014.
CS 577b Software Engineering II -- Introduction
Release & Deployment ITIL Version 3
Understanding (and Untangling) Verification and Validation Requirements ISO 9001 vs. CMMI-Dev 1.2.
Capability Maturity Model Integrated
CMMI Course Summary CMMI course Module 9..
1 The Continuous Representation. 2 UNIT 2 Topics covered in this unit include Additional terminology Practices – The fundamental building blocks Process.
Copyright © 2009, Systems and Software Consortium, Inc. Introduction to an Integrated Lean Thinking, Six Sigma  and CMMI  Approach for Process Improvement.
8. CMMI Standards and Certifications
Copyright Course Technology 1999
COMPANY CONFIDENTIAL Page 1 Final Findings Briefing Client ABC Ltd CMMI (SW) – Ver 1.2 Staged Representation Conducted by: QAI India SM - CMMI is a service.
Light-Weight CMMI (Capability Maturity Model Integration ) Stage 1: Requirement Development and Project Planning For NSC Open Source Projects Dr. Chaw-Kwei.
Process Assessment Motivation SEI Capability Maturity Model
1 The Continuous Representation. 2 UNIT 2 Topics covered in this unit include Additional terminology Practices – The fundamental building blocks Process.
CMMi What is CMMi? Basic terms Levels Common Features Assessment process List of KPAs for each level.
Demystifying the Business Analysis Body of Knowledge Central Iowa IIBA Chapter December 7, 2005.
1 / x Project Planning CMMI Project Planning Jean-Luc Deprez Robin Leblon.
1 / x Verification CMMI Verification Hendrik van den Berge Kevin Mets.
10/16/2015Bahill1 Organizational Innovation and Deployment Causal Analysis and Resolution 5 Optimizing 4 Quantitatively Managed 3 Defined 2 Managed Continuous.
Software process improvement Framework for SPI SPI support groups, maturity and immaturity models Assessment and gap analysis Education and training Selection.
Adaptive Processes Overview Adaptive Processes©. Adaptive Processes © Adaptive ProcessesSimpler, Faster, Better2 Objective To provide an over view of.
1/18 CMMI Risk Management Jense Seurynck Daan Van Britsom Risk Management.
CMMI: PROCESS AND PRODUCT QUALITY ASSURANCE Lieven Lemiengre Thomas Spranghers.
Georgia Institute of Technology CS 4320 Fall 2003.
1 © Mahindra Satyam 2009 Mahindra Satyam Confidential Welcome To CMMI Introduction.
Everything You Ever Wanted to Know About CMMI in 30 Minutes or LESS CCS TECHNICAL SERVICES (484) CCS TECHNICAL SERVICES (484) William.
Capability Maturity Model Integration Project Monitoring and Control Software Management 2008 – 2009 Alexander Ide Niels Soetens.
1 / x CMMI Measurement & Analysis Pieter Cailliau Stijn De Vos Measurement & Analysis.
1 / x CMMI Technical Solution Rob Vanden Meersche Dieter Van den Bulcke.
Business Analysis. Business Analysis Concepts Enterprise Analysis ► Identify business opportunities ► Understand the business strategy ► Identify Business.
Capability Maturity Model Integration Project Monitoring and Control Software Management 2008 – 2009 Alexander Ide Niels Soetens.
Purpose: The purpose of CMM Integration is to provide guidance for improving your organization’s processes and your ability to manage the development,
Guidelines for Process
CMMI November 25 th Copyright © 2015 Accenture All rights reserved. The aim of the presentation is to introduce Capability Maturity Model Integrated.
需求管理 Capability Maturity Model Integrated Author : Softare Engineering Institute Carnegie Mellon University.
9 th Annual National Defense Industrial Association CMMI Technology Conference and User Group November 18, 2009 Denver, Colorado, USA Bill Smith, CEO Leading.
Copyright © | Trade secret and confidential Page 1 Innovative, Professional, Fact Based and Eustressed© Maruthi Quality Management Services Ptv. Ltd..,
Space and Airborne Systems Prepared For 3rd Annual CMMI Technology Conference Presented In Denver, CO Tom Cowles November 19, 2003 Peer Reviews For CMMI.
 CMMI  REQUIREMENT DEVELOPMENT  SPECIFIC AND GENERIC GOALS  SG1: Develop CUSTOMER Requirement  SG2: Develop Product Requirement  SG3: Analyze.
MGT 461 Lecture #27 Project Execution and Control Ghazala Amin.
Unit 8: Implementation, Part II Seminar Wednesday pm ET.
Pittsburgh, PA CMMI Acquisition Module - Page M5-1 CMMI ® Sponsored by the U.S. Department of Defense © 2005 by Carnegie Mellon University This.
COMPGZ07 Project Management CMMI Project Planning Lecture 5b Graham Collins, UCL.
CMMI1 Capability Maturity Model Integration Eyal Ben-Ari 8/2006.
MSA Orientation – v203a 1 What’s RIGHT with the CMMI?!? Pat O’Toole
Company LOGO. Company LOGO PE, PMP, PgMP, PME, MCT, PRINCE2 Practitioner.
Figures – Chapter 26. Figure 26.1 Factors affecting software product quality.
CMMI for Services, Version 1.3 Speaker: Business Excellence Date:
Capability Maturity Model Integration
Presented To: 3rd Annual CMMI Technology Conference and User Group
CMMI November 22nd 2017.
CS 577b Software Engineering II -- Introduction
CMMI – Staged Representation
Engineering Processes
CMMI November 2018.
Engineering Processes
Presentation transcript:

1 / 25 IPM CMMI Integrated Project Management (IPM) Dieter De Paepe & Sarah Bourgeois

2 / 25 IPM Integrated  A project has initial knowledge n Standard processes in the company On testing, management, development,... n Initial facts and assets Experience, size of team, time,... n Stakeholders Clients, managers, marketers, developers,...  Based on these, IPM tries to compose: n Project’s defined process = define integration of the standard processes in the project n Useful work products (environment, plans,...) n Feedback loops to other process area’s Project Management(IPM) Purpose

3 / 25 IPM Integrated Project Management(IPM) Situated CM OPFOPD MA OT OID OPP PPQA PMCPP IPM SAM RSKM QPM REQM RD TS PI VER VAL DAR CAR ProcessProjectEngineeringSupport PROMANSUPENG ML 5 ML4 ML3 ML2

4 / 25 IPM Integrated Project Management(IPM) Situated

5 / 25 Integrated Process Management (IPM) Benefits  The interfaces between the different standard processes are revealed and gives us new information.  New weaknesses in the integration of all involved assets and stakeholders are discovered.  New collected information can serve for future projects. IPM

6 / 25 IPM Integrated Process Management (IPM) Specific Goals (1)  SG 1 Use the Project’s Defined Process n SP1.1 Establish the Project’s Defined Process Implemented? Partially  Unintended through the collection of documentation on the sub processes But no written ‘defined process’ found in any project Possible improvement  Integrate all useful documentation in one integrated document  Based on: in-house knowledge and experience [1] SCRUM DefinitionSCRUM Definition

7 / 25 IPM Integrated Process Management (IPM) Specific Goals (2) n SP1.2 Use Organizational Process Assets for Planning Project Activities Implemented? Partially  Knowledge of previous projects are used in the current projects. However: no explicit documentation regarding these assets. Possible improvement  Make more structured reports about experiences in previous projects and support these with measurements if possible.  Use dream questions. [2] Dream questions

8 / 25 IPM Integrated Process Management (IPM) Dream question extracts “Sit together with the responsible persons when…” “The lack of processes and responsibilities during previous semester is something to be avoided in the future.” “Putting everything together in the end can be very 'painful‘.” “…have conversation with the client, some at the beginning of the project to know ‘what he wanted’ and later another to keep informed during the course of the project.” “A meeting at the start of the project with all of the stakeholders could have solved this problem early on.” “…trying to set up the infrastructure…” “Communication!”

9 / 25 IPM Integrated Process Management (IPM) Specific Goals (3) n SP1.3 Establish the Project’s Work Environment Implemented? Yes  Communication channels : wiki, fora,..  Continuous integration platform : hudson,...  Development environment  Test environment Possible improvements  Good documentation on installations present [3] Document describing setting up work environmentDocument describing setting up work environment

10 / 25 IPM Integrated Process Management (IPM) Specific Goals (4) n SP1.4 Integrate Plans Implemented? Partially  In most projects there is a long term planning available, integrating review meetings, internal meetings, deadlines.  In this planning, stakeholders are involved.  But the planning is not always strictly followed, when sudden unexpected needs come up. Possible improvements  Anticipate on these unexpected needs by better integration of the separate plans. [4] Project planning

11 / 25 IPM Integrated Process Management (IPM) Specific Goals (5) n SP1.5 Manage the Project Using the Integrated Plans Implemented? Partially  Most projects have a quality assurance manager who is responsible for the correct implementation of the long term plan.  Most projects do have some estimations but not of all relevant factors. Possible improvements  More complete and documented measurements.  Better monitoring to verify the plan is being followed. [5] Overview of implemented testsOverview of implemented tests

12 / 25 IPM Integrated Process Management (IPM) Tracking measurements

13 / 25 IPM Integrated Process Management (IPM) Specific Goals (6) n SP1.6 Contribute to the Organizational Process Assets Implemented? Hardly  Few contributions to the ‘asset pool’ found.  Only some on wiki and in meetings reports. Possible improvements  Better defined format for the contributed assets.  Spend time on contributing assets throughout the whole project.  Collect more relevant information. [6] Meeting reportsMeeting reports

14 / 25 IPM Integrated Process Management (IPM) Specific Goals (7)  SG 2 Coordinate and Collaborate with Relevant Stakeholders n SP2.1 Manage Stakeholder Involvement Implemented? Yes  Involvement of the internal stakeholders is well defined. Responsibilities are clear. Workload is divided amongst the team members.  External stakeholders are involved periodically or at appropriate times. Possible improvements  None [6] Meeting reportsMeeting reports

15 / 25 IPM Integrated Process Management (IPM) Specific Goals (8) n SP2.2 Manage Dependencies Remark : Not all projects are dependant from external stakeholders Implemented? Partially  For internal dependencies: all projects plan meetings for ‘synchronization’.  There are contact session between dependant external stakeholders when this dependency causes problems.  In most projects, dependencies are defined in documents. Possible improvements  Better documentation [7] External dependancy documentationExternal dependancy documentation

16 / 25 IPM Integrated Process Management (IPM) Specific Goals (9) n SP2.3 Resolve Coordination Issues Implemented? No Possible improvements  Assign the responsibility of coordinating between stakeholders to one person.  Anticipate and prevent possible issues and document this.

17 / 25 IPM Integrated Process Management (IPM) Generic Practices GG 2 (1)  GP2.1 Establish an Organizational Policy n Senior management has expressed expectations and guidelines for IPM.  GP2.2 Plan the Process n Document chosen methodes of the integrated project plan.  GP2.3 Provide Resources n Time is spent on integration aspects. n Assets from previous projects. n Tools: Problem-tracking and trouble-reporting packages [8] Initial project assignment [9] Trac websites [2] Dream questions

18 / 25 IPM Integrated Process Management (IPM) Generic Practices GG 2 (2)  GP2.4 Assign Responsibility n Project team Follow specified plans. Report, communicate & resolve problems. Document project decisions & problems n Stakeholders Communicate & coordinate [10] Team assignmentsTeam assignments [11] War room listWar room list

19 / 25 IPM Integrated Process Management (IPM) War room list  Overview (possibly a document) containing: n Roles & responsibilities n Action item list Who needs to do what till when? n Risk list – with mitigation strategies n Key decisions DateDescription 11/11/2008The project name is 'Hadra'. 16/02/2009Ruby is chosen as programming language. 16/02/2009The feedback feature is dropped.

20 / 25 IPM Integrated Process Management (IPM) Generic Practices GG 2 (3)  GP2.5 Train People n Introduction about IPM Team Stakeholders n Training: group coördination, integrating processes,…  GP2.6 Manage Configurations n Project plan is placed under configuration management. [12] This presentation

21 / 25 IPM Integrated Process Management (IPM) Generic Practices GG 2 (4)  GP2.7 Identify and Involve Relevant Stakeholders n See SP 2.1  GP2.8 Monitor and Control the Process n Quality manager: Adjust project plan if needed.  GP2.9 Objectively Evaluate Adherence n Monitor IPM practices.  GP2.10 Review Status with Higher Level Management n Periodic review with stakeholders. [6] Meeting reportsMeeting reports

22 / 25 IPM Integrated Process Management (IPM) Generic Practices GG 3 (1)  GP3.1 Establish a Defined Process n SP 1.1  GP3.2 Collect Improvement Information n SP 1.6 [1] SCRUM DefinitionSCRUM Definition [6] Meeting reportsMeeting reports

23 / 25 IPM Integrated Process Management (IPM) Findings  Strengths n  Opportunities for Improvement n  Proposed Actions n <>

24 / 25 IPM Integrated Process Management (IPM) Glossary  CMMICapability Maturity Model Integration  IPMIntegrated Process Managent  ML3Maturity Level 3, process area has the restriction to take company standards in account.  MANProject management, process area is situated in de project management domain.  Defined ProcessSee definition slide 2  Process assetsIn-house knowledge, policies, measurements,...  Work productUseful result of a process

25 / 25 IPM Integrated Process Management (IPM) References  CMMI for Development version  …